Technical Competencies

The Engineer III is expected to possess working knowledge and hands-on experience in one or more of the following manufacturing and process technologies:

  • Cleanroom assembly of miniature and precision medical device components.
  • Laser welding processes.
  • Resistance welding processes.
  • Injection molding processes.
  • Silicone molding processes.
  • Sterile packaging technologies.
  • Process development and process optimization methodologies.
  • Statistical analysis and process characterization techniques.
  • Medical device Design Control requirements and documentation.
  • Risk management principles and Design for Manufacturability (DFM).
  • Validation methodologies including IQ, OQ, PQ, and TMV.
